This happens to others just using regular taxis.  You can be told that the place you asked to go to is closed or full or changed policy to All Inclusive, or any number of things and be driven to another place.  It can be confusing if you have never been to Cozumel before.  But your best bet is to stick with your original destination. 

 

There should have been a sign that said "Maya Palancar" that could have clued you in.

 

You should contact the service that provided the driver for the day and let them know you are displeased with the actions of Mario.

How much is the cab ride to Playa Palancar? Or Playa Maya area?

Fare to Playa Mia, Sanchos, Nachi, or PAradise Beach should be about $17 each way -- as mentioned above, the cab fare covers up to 4 passengers in the cab.  If you have a bigger group there are van taxis available for a higher price.

We we’re almost scammed at Cozumel with a taxi driver.  I had researched the various Beach clubs and decided to go to Paradise Beach.  At the taxi stand at Puerto Maya , a taxi driver told some of our group who arrived early that Paradise Beach was not the price I had been quoted (a lie of course)and was not that nice, and that he had a much better place he could take us to.  Although some of our group seemed interested, I said no, we wanted to go to Paradise Beach.  

 

I’m sure he was getting a kickback for everyone he brought into the place he suggested.  And Paradise beach is still our go to place in Cozumel. Be very wary of taxi drivers!
